Mistake Continuity: When the crew hauls the female orca aboard the boat, the harpoon line is wrapped around her entire body several times. When they cut the rope and drop her into the water, the line is wrapped only around her tail. When the male orca is pushing her at sea, the rope is again wrapped around her entire body.

Mistake Continuity: Sometimes the orca is seen with the nick in his dorsal fin, and sometimes there is no nick. The is most obvious when he sinks the boats in the harbor. When he heads into the harbor, the nick is visible, when he leaves the harbor, there is no nick in the fin.

Mistake Factual error: Near the beginning, when the crew is chasing the great white shark and trying to avoid hitting the raft, Captain Nolan yells to the pilot "Hard to port." The pilot turns the wheel to the right, which is starboard.

Mistake Continuity: At the end when Orca leaps from the water to land on the ice causing Harris to slide down, the ice isn't there then all of a sudden it appears when Orca lands on it.

Mistake Revealing: In the beginning of the movie when Orca is about to hit the great white shark out of the water the stick that holds the "head" of the great white is visible as it swims by.
